BAD HABITS

 

I never use to drink, never before / never use to smoke, ever before. Kept your company too long, you led me into the den of sin, I got hooked while trying to save you from yourself, now myself alone has nasty habits. Your own bad habits you’ve overcome, you got me hooked on your habits then left me alone, after years of sharing your jaded life: I against my true will, did the things I said I’d never do. You left me all alone for another lover and dropped me like a bad habit. While I rescued your heartless and numb heart, I pulled you through and left myself behind to wither and die. Addicted to you and all torn apart. I sit contemplating suicide, hoping to die, since you dropped me like a bad habit. One hard lesson learned is "life goes on"; While I die alone”. As the plane goes down; The First mask you should put on, is your own.!
